Output 68fcccba596c7a86a13a4fc4df0e75a8b26ed2274bbd58d0b126e33c8eb786bb:1

value
68289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0002507830af21566bb682590c200ba357547ed3 OP_EQUAL
address
31h4hM3sDb1q4wgMAKBSXjgKkjqxguDJc8
transaction
68fcccba596c7a86a13a4fc4df0e75a8b26ed2274bbd58d0b126e33c8eb786bb
spent
true